Добрый день, подскажите как будет правильно передать реквизит на форму создания нового элемента.
У меня есть форма справочника, я из нее создаю новый элемент, по умолчанию у меня открывается форма списка, нажимаю создать новый и там мне нужно подставлять данные из первой формы.
Надеюсь поятно объяснил.
У меня есть форма справочника, я из нее создаю новый элемент, по умолчанию у меня открывается форма списка, нажимаю создать новый и там мне нужно подставлять данные из первой формы.
Надеюсь поятно объяснил.
По теме из базы знаний
Ответы
Подписаться на ответы
Инфостарт бот
Сортировка:
Древо развёрнутое
Свернуть все
А зачем вам форма списка ? Сразу новую форму открывайте:
ЭлементыОтбора = Новый Структура("Поставщик, Склад", СсылкаНаПоставщика, СсылкаНаСклад);
ПараметрыФормы = Новый Структура("ЗначенияЗаполнения", ЭлементыОтбора);
ОткрытьФорму("Документ.Накладная.ФормаОбъекта", ПараметрыФормы);
(2) Да это было бы проще, но у нас логика такая чтобы была возможность выбрать уже созданный элемент. Да и даже если я сделаю кнопка из первой формы создать элемент, минуя форму списка, то пользователи будут путаться, лезть в список искать запись, нажимать на создать новый, где у них не будет заполняться нужный реквизит и т.д
(2) Иногда нужно определиться в какую подгруппу элемент должен попасть.
К примеру, создаём сначала номенклатуру „мыло душистое“, а потом „ацетон“.
Перед созданием первого мы хотим зайти в группу „мыла“, а для второго — „растворители“.
При создании заполнить наименование (может слегка его изменив), артикул, ставку НДС, страну изготовителя, поставщика и ещё чего-нибудь типа штрихкода.
Был такой фокус на простых формах через обработчик ожидания.
К примеру, создаём сначала номенклатуру „мыло душистое“, а потом „ацетон“.
Перед созданием первого мы хотим зайти в группу „мыла“, а для второго — „растворители“.
При создании заполнить наименование (может слегка его изменив), артикул, ставку НДС, страну изготовителя, поставщика и ещё чего-нибудь типа штрихкода.
Был такой фокус на простых формах через обработчик ожидания.
Для получения уведомлений об ответах подключите телеграм бот:
Инфостарт бот